    How does PALS training improve procedural skills in EMS providers?

    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) training enhances procedural skills to a huge extent in emergency medical providers. Studies show that PALS-trained-EMS squads have higher success rates in intubations, vascular access, and intraosseous line placement as compared to non-PALS-trained squads.

    PALS training leads to improved procedural skills such as successful intubations (85% vs. 48%), vascular access in shock/arrest cases (100% vs. 70%), and intraosseous line placement (100% vs. 55%). However, while PALS training enhances technical skills, it does not directly impact mortality rates in pediatric resuscitations.     1. How does PALS training improve EMS skills?

    Here is how the PALS training improves skills in EMS providers.

    • It results in better intubation, vascular access, and intraosseous line placement. 
    • Next, the training boosts knowledge and skills in pediatric resuscitation. 
    • Videoconferencing is as effective as face-to-face training for PALS renewal. 
    • The course enhances immediate knowledge of pediatric resuscitation for all professional groups.
    1. What is the impact of integrating teamwork training into PALS programs?

    Integrating teamwork training into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) programs affects the teamwork, collaboration, and patient safety culture. Here are the key impacts:

    • Improved perceptions of teamwork and collaboration, situational awareness, and decision-making abilities.
    • Enhanced attitudes toward teamwork in healthcare, leading to positive changes in teamwork skills. 
    • Significant improvement in teamwork skills, including team structure, leadership, situation monitoring, mutual support, and communication.
    • Better teamwork behaviors and patient care performance during simulated patient resuscitations.
    1. Is videoconferencing an effective method for providing PALS recertification?

    Yes, videoconferencing is an effective method for providing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) recertification. Studies show that videoconferencing is as effective as face-to-face instruction in improving knowledge, psychomotor skills, and confidence in performing resuscitation skills. It offers a practical and cost-effective way to deliver PALS renewal to geographically isolated providers, ensuring non-inferior outcomes as compared to traditional methods. 

    1. How does the integration of high-fidelity simulators affect PALS training in rural settings?

    In rural healthcare settings, integrating high-fidelity simulators into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) training has shown positive impacts. Here are the effects of high-fidelity simulators on PALS training in rural settings:

    • Improved Skill Performance: Participants using high-fidelity simulators showed significantly better skill performance compared to those using low-fidelity manikins. 
    • Enhanced Knowledge Retention: The experimental group had better retention of knowledge and skills compared to the control group, even six months after the training. 
    • Decreased Decline in Skills: 

    The group trained with high-fidelity simulators had lower declines in written exam scores and self-efficacy compared to the control group.

    1. What is the participation rate of pediatricians in PALS courses?

    Pediatricians have a low participation rate in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) courses, with only a small percentage of pediatricians attending PALS courses. Studies show that pediatricians in general office practice represent a rate of 0.81% of participants in PALS courses. 

    1. What are the recommendations for neonatal and pediatric life support training in the USA?

    Here are the key recommendations for neonatal and pediatric life support training in the USA:

    • Regular Certification: Healthcare professionals should obtain and renew certification in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) and Neonatal Resuscitation Program (NRP) regularly.
    • Hands-On Practice: Training practices should include hands-on simulations to ensure practical skill proficiency.
    • Evidence-Based Guidelines: Follow the latest updated guidelines for evidence-based practices.
    • Interdisciplinary Training: Encourage interdisciplinary training sessions involving doctors, nurses, and other healthcare staff.
    • Ongoing Education: Participate in continuing education to stay updated with the latest advancements in life support techniques and protocols.
    1. What is the impact of renewal training on pediatric resuscitation skills?

    Renewal training significantly impacts pediatric resuscitation skills, as evidenced by recent studies:

    • PALS renewal training improves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) performance scores. 
    • High-frequency CPR training enhances CPR performance during real events.
    • Spaced instruction results in better retention of procedural skills in pediatric resuscitation.
    • Serial resuscitation refreshers with coaching improve knowledge and comfort levels.
    • Implementation of a pediatric resuscitation curriculum enhances comfort in treating critically ill pediatric patients.
    • Modified BLS training improves nurses’ knowledge and skills in pediatric resuscitation. 

    Conclusion

    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) training greatly improves EMS providers’ skills, helping them succeed more often in intubations, getting veins for IVs, and placing intraosseous lines. Although PALS improves technical abilities, it doesn’t directly reduce death rates in cases of pediatric emergencies. Online PALS recertification is crucial for keeping these skills sharp, making sure providers are ready to handle emergencies with children effectively.
